How to Implement SocialMedia
• Build target community
• Create individual connections
• Create engagement >> Like
• Use feedback >> Listen
• Solve their problems
• Show credentials /quality through discussions
• Participate in industry groups as well as your client
• Pose questions to create involvement
• Create thought-leadership
• Real power in viral marketing >> SEO & traffic

Time Consuming, So What Does It Bring?
• Increaseyour visibility
• Improveyour connectability
• Improveyour Google PageRank
• Enhance your search engineresults
• Company reference checks
• Increaserelevancy potential hiring
• Measure health of a company
• Measure health of an industry
• Track startups
• Ask for advice and solve problems

Last But NOT Least : Set a Market Budget!
• % of run rate, depends on:
- Industry, size, growth stage
- Startup 10% / Maturity 2-3%
• Budget allocation
- Developing brand
- Cost promotion
• Track return on investment
• Revise your budget frequently
